Part I 序(Introduction)
1、BI分为企业版和self-service BI,对个人用户来说,POWER BI DESKTOP是很好的数据智能处理软件。
2、Perhaps one of the most important things to note about Power BI is that it is designed with business analysts and Excel users in mind.
3、POWER BI DESKTOP的四个主要模块
数据获取:Data acquisition
数据建模:Data modelling
视觉对象:Data visualisation
报告分发:Report distribution
4、为什么要学DAX
In much the same way, if you learn Power BI basics but don't learn the DAX language and how SSAS Tabular works, you will be limited to simplistic capabilities that restrict the value you can get from the tool.you definitely need some structured learning if you want to be good at using this tool. I have learnt that Excel users need practice, practice, practice. This book is designed to give you practice and to teach you how to write DAX. If you can’t write DAX, you will never be good at Power BI or Power Pivot for Excel.
很大程度上来讲,如果不学DAX语言只学习基础的Power BI和了解SSAS Tabular是如何工作的,那这个软件工具的价值就大大受限了。传统的EXCEL用户需要大量练习,本书也设计提供了大量练习,教你如何书写DAX。如果不能自如地书写DAX公式,那就不能很好的掌握Power BI 或EXCEL中的 Power Pivot.
